What is FlightOps Drone OS?
FlightOps Drone OS is a flight automation software designed for simultaneous BVLOS (Beyond Visual Line of Sight) multi-drone operations. According to the vendor, it aims to minimize human intervention, reduce human error, accelerate response times, decrease planning durations, and streamline the integration of flight capabilities into broader business processes. The software is suitable for companies of various sizes, including small, medium, and large enterprises. FlightOps Drone OS caters to industries such as logistics, public safety, air mobility, and inspection. It is used by drone operators, manufacturers, developers, and software engineers.
Key Features
Onboard Decision Making: According to the vendor, FlightOps Drone OS enables commercial drones to make autonomous decisions, reducing dependency on communications and human operators. This feature is said to enhance the overall autonomy and reliability of drone operations.
Smart Energy Management: The vendor claims that FlightOps constantly calculates energy consumption and return home routes, optimizing flight paths and energy usage for efficient and fail-safe missions.
Strategic Airspace Deconfliction: According to the vendor, FlightOps software platform plans real-time flight paths that avoid no-fly-zones, ground obstacles, and other air vehicles, ensuring safe and efficient operations.
Communication Loss Resilience: The vendor states that FlightOps onboard solution reduces the risk of communication loss between the drone and the ground control station, enabling independent mission continuation or return home.
Automated Takeoff & Landing: FlightOps manages synchronized takeoff and landing processes, allowing multiple drones to operate efficiently from the same location, as claimed by the vendor.
4G LTE / 5G Connectivity: According to the vendor, FlightOps utilizes advanced connectivity technologies to ensure reliable and high-speed communication between the drone and the ground control station, enabling real-time data transmission and control.
Dynamic Routing: The vendor claims that FlightOps uses smart algorithms to generate optimal flight plans on the fly, adapting to changing conditions and ensuring safe and efficient operations.
Multiple UAS Operation: According to the vendor, FlightOps platform allows the automated operation of multiple drones simultaneously, optimizing resource utilization and mission efficiency.
UAS Agnostic: The vendor states that FlightOps platform supports the operation of multiple types of drones with different auto-pilots, ensuring compatibility and interoperability across various drone platforms.
GPS Loss Resilience: According to the vendor, FlightOps onboard software enables the drone to maintain control and continue its mission using alternative navigation methods in extreme situations of simultaneous GPS and communication loss.
